Why it stands out
The 2020 Nissan Murano stands out as a plush, upmarket alternative in the midsize SUV class. It pairs a strong engine with a great ride quality, and its safety features help explain why it remains appealing to shoppers who value comfort and confidence behind the wheel. Owners also tend to praise its smooth ride and well-appointed feel, with some comparing it favorably to higher-end vehicles.
That appeal is tempered by a few clear drawbacks. The Murano’s aging design and outdated technology make it feel less current than newer rivals, and its generation is described as rapidly aging in the face of fresh competition. Some owners also note the lack of a powered liftgate and smaller trunk space compared with competitors, which can matter for buyers who prioritize convenience and cargo room.

2020 Nissan Murano Trims
| Trim type | MSRP |
|---|---|
| Platinum AWD | $45,530 |
| Platinum FWD | $43,930 |
| S FWD | $31,730 |
| S AWD | $33,330 |
| SL FWD | $39,880 |
| SL AWD | $41,480 |
| SV FWD | $35,360 |
| SV AWD | $36,960 |

What should I look for when buying a used 2020 Nissan Murano?
At 71.2% accident-free, a meaningful share of listings has prior incidents — history verification is especially important.
You should start with a vehicle history report and then prioritize a pre-purchase inspection, especially if the listing price looks unusually strong. Focus on overall condition, signs of prior bodywork, and whether the cabin and tech features still feel consistent with the mileage and asking price.
Key things to evaluate:
- Trim level: The Murano comes in S, SV, SL, and Platinum grades. The base trim is the bare-bones version, while SV adds heated outside mirrors, adaptive cruise control, and rear sonar; SL adds traffic-sign recognition technology; Platinum adds a leather-wrapped steering wheel and more premium appointments.
- Powertrain: You get a standard 3.5-liter V6 with 260 horsepower and 240 pound-feet of torque, paired with a CVT. It’s not the quickest off the line, but it has no trouble overtaking on the highway, and AWD is available.
- Safety package: Safety Shield 360 is standard on SV, SL, and Platinum. It includes forward-collision warning with automatic emergency braking and pedestrian detection, blind-spot monitoring and warning, rear cross-traffic alert, lane-departure warning, high beam assist, rear automatic braking, and a rearview camera. The base trim does not get this full suite.
- Infotainment: Every Murano gets an 8-inch touchscreen with Apple CarPlay, Android Auto, four USB ports, Bluetooth, satellite radio, a six-speaker audio system, and voice recognition. Higher trims can add an 11-speaker Bose system, HD Radio, navigation, and NissanConnect Services on Platinum.
- Fuel efficiency: The Murano is rated at 20 mpg city, 28 mpg highway, and 23 mpg combined.
Which 2020 Nissan Murano trim should I buy?
The 2020 Nissan Murano is offered in 4 trim levels: S, SV, SL, and Platinum.
Here's the short version:
- S: This is the entry point, but it’s the most stripped-down version of the Murano. Choose it only if you want the lowest starting price and can live without the added safety and convenience features found higher up.
- SV: This is the best-value trim for most shoppers because it adds the important safety technology, plus heated outside mirrors, adaptive cruise control, and rear sonar without jumping all the way to the pricier upper trims.
- SL: This trim adds traffic-sign recognition technology and upgrades the wheels, making it a good fit if you want more equipment and a more premium feel.
- Platinum: This is the most upscale version, with premium appointments and the most features, but it’s best for you only if you’re willing to pay for the top-end experience.
Safety Shield 360 is standard on SV, SL, and Platinum, so those trims are the ones to target if safety tech matters most.

Is the 2020 Nissan Murano safe?
The 2020 Nissan Murano earns all good IIHS ratings except in the headlight category, where it was not rated, and it received a superior mark in front crash prevention. It also earns five-star ratings from NHTSA except in rollover, where it is rated four-star.
It earns an 8/10 safety score from our experts.
Nissan Safety Shield 360 is standard on SV, SL, and Platinum, and it includes forward-collision warning with automatic emergency braking and pedestrian detection, blind-spot monitoring and warning, rear cross-traffic alert, lane-departure warning, high beam assist, rear automatic braking, and a rearview camera. The base trim does not get that full suite.
One caveat is that the Murano does not offer the more advanced driver-assist setup found in some rivals, so if you want the latest semi-automated driving aids, you may want to shop carefully.
